Ilana Lashley
Ilana Lashley (born 6 March 2002) is a Saint Lucian footballer who plays as a midfielder. She has been a member of the Saint Lucia women's national team.

International career
Lashley represented Saint Lucia at the 2020 CONCACAF Women's U-20 Championship.[1] She capped at senior level during the 2019 Women Windward Islands Tournament and the 2020 CONCACAF Women's Olympic Qualifying Championship qualification.[2]
